In the last month or so, the way the Modern player handles broswer window resizing has changed. I have multiple web objects in a project which have set dimensions to correctly fit their content (ie so that the content completely fills the web object without any scroll bars). Previously, the contents scaled with the browser window size but now this is no longer happening for newly published content (previously published content seems unaffected). We know this issue with web objects was definitely a pain! I'm happy to share that we just released Update 34 (Build 3.34.20804.0) for Storyline 360!
This update includes the bug fix for Web Objects that were misaligned and sized incorrectly in the published output!
